גָּרַשׁ
gârash(gaw-rash')

to drive out from a possession; especially to expatriate or divorce

47 occurrencesOld TestamentUncommon Word

Definition

Strong’s Definition

to drive out from a possession; especially to expatriate or divorce

Translated in KJV as

cast up (out)divorced (woman)drive away (forth, out)expel[idiom] surely put awaytroublethrust out.

Etymology

a primitive root;
